It is a bridge that carries one road or railway line above another either with or without subsidiary roads, for communication between the two sides.
As the traffic on the road goes on increasing and we don’t have any space left in both the dimensions, then the only option left will be to go to the third dimension and that is done through flyover construction. Reason Behind Going For A Flyover
At railway crossing where there is high traffic congestion in terms of the frequency of trains passing by or the traffic on the road, in both the cases the flyover should be provided along the road. Here the flyover becomes indispensable. Railway Crossing
Simple Flyovers In this case, the main road is used for fast traffic, which is made to pass at a high level by a bridge, providing ramps on both the approaches; and the slow traffic is made to pass underneath. Thus the traffics pass at two different levels, and leave no chance for an accident. Road Crossing
It requires a very large area of land. All conflicting streams of traffic are avoided, and so traffic can move at its own speed. This is more advantageous than a roundabout, as there is no necessity for weaving and slowing down of traffic. Cloverleaf Junction
Components Of Flyover
Basic Components SUPER-STRUCTURE : The superstructure consists of the components that actually span the obstacle the bridge is intended to cross and includes the following: Bridge deck Structural members Parapets (bridge railings), handrails, sidewalk, lighting and some drainage features.
SUB-STRUCTURE : The substructure consists of all of the parts that support the superstructure. The main components are abutments or end-bents, piers or interior bents, footings, and piling. Abutments support the extreme ends of the bridge and confine the approach embankment, allowing the embankment to be built up to grade with the planned bridge deck.
Span: The distance between two bridge supports, whether they are columns, towers or the wall of a canyon. Beam: A rigid, usually horizontal, structural element Pier: A vertical supporting structure, such as a pillar. Contd. Beam Pier
Abutment: A structure to support the lateral pressure of an arch or span. E.g. at the ends of a bridge. Bearings: A bridge bearing is a component of a bridge which connects the piers and deck. Approach Slab: It provides a transition between the roadway pavement and the bridge. Parapet: A low protective wall along the edge of bridge. Contd.
Merits of flyover Flyovers play a major role in streamlining the traffic control system. Through flyovers plenty of time is saved avoiding congestion. Pollution effect is reduced. Flyovers reduce the risk of accidents Flyovers also contribute a lot to the aesthetics of the city. The persons traveling on the flyover can enjoy the panoramic view of the city. Merits And Demerits
Demerits of flyover Flyovers are not as a rule suitable for built up areas as they require a large area and also it is costly. Lack of proper management in the flyover construction may cause many problems. Loss in the case of accidents is increased. The risk of accidents is reduced but in case an accident occurs the loss may be more. As the vehicle is at a high elevation, during accidents there is more chance of losing life. As the people who cannot risk their lives in relying on it are not using it. So, it’s ironical that the flyover has become a liability here instead of an asset for the city.

Kathipara Junction:- Kathipara Junction is an important road junction in Chennai , India . It is located at Alandur , ( St.Thomas Mount), south of Guindy , at the intersection of the Grand Southern Trunk Road (NH 45), Inner Ring Road , Anna Salai and the Mount- Poonamallee Road. Kathipara flyover is the largest cloverleaf flyover in the whole of Asia. Top Flyovers Of India
Hebbal Flyover -Bangalore : Bangalore The ‘ Garden city of India ‘ has some of the great flyovers. Bangalore electronic city flyover is the biggest flyover in India. Hebbal Flyover connects connects the Outer Ring Road and Bellary Road and is one of the best double road flyover.
